 Plain-English summary Congressional Research Service

Return of General Aviation to Ronald Reagan Washington National Airport Act of 2005 - Directs the Secretary of Transportation to permit the resumption of nonscheduled, commercial air carrier (air charter) and general aviation operations at Ronald Reagan Washington National Airport. Requires the Secretary, in complying with such requirements, to consult with the general aviation industry. Declares that nothing shall be construed to limit or otherwise affect the requirement of the Vision 100 - Century of Aviation Reauthorization Act that the Secretary of Homeland Security develop and implement a security plan to permit general aviation aircraft to land and take off at the airport.
